China Uses Satellite Remote Sensing for Gyirong Landslide Monitoring
China's Ministry of Emergency Management is employing satellite remote sensing to monitor and analyze landslides and debris flows in Gyirong County.

China's Ministry of Emergency Management has deployed satellite remote sensing technology to enhance monitoring and analysis of debris flows and landslides that occurred in Gyirong County, Tibet. The method provides continuous and detailed insights into the disaster zone.
The system, operated by the National Center for Disaster Reduction, utilizes data from a series of satellites, including "Emergency Disaster Reduction" and "High Resolution" series. This allows for precise tracing of the debris flow origins, such as ice and rock collapses, by analyzing anomalies in river channels and mountain vegetation.
Furthermore, data from "Resource" and "Beijing-3" satellites are used to identify landslide-affected areas, locate potential barrier lakes, and assess downstream damages. The system continuously monitors changes in the area of these lakes and any overflow.
The debris flow event took place on August 26, 2026, at the Gyirong border crossing, resulting in significant casualties and missing persons. Rescue and recovery efforts are ongoing in the affected region.
